Output 51170eba1fafb971b4031339e50da9236b59b0d41565935a7a996ae52e381388:0

value
77756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 264343ad95b4d7dd5633e10b5dc02f61818de828 OP_EQUALVERIFY OP_CHECKSIG
address
14VKFuBj38gxeVshwF8QYdpGhpJnMS15kA
transaction
51170eba1fafb971b4031339e50da9236b59b0d41565935a7a996ae52e381388
spent
true